Is voluntary prayer permissible after the Imam sits on the pulpit on Friday?

Voluntary prayer ceases immediately upon the Imam sitting on the pulpit. Only the person entering the mosque is permitted to pray the greeting of the mosque (Tahiyat al-Masjid), and that prayer should be brief. This ruling is established based on the narration from Tha'labah ibn Abi Malik, stating that during the time of Umar ibn al-Khattab, people prayed until Umar emerged. Once Umar sat on the pulpit and the muezzins gave the call to prayer, the people sat and conversed until the muezzin fell silent and Umar stood up, at which point everyone became silent. This indicates the widespread acceptance of this practice among them.
